How Dangerous Are the Roads in Loganville, Georgia?
Loganville has a Road Danger Score of 85/100 (High Road Danger). Over the five years from 2020 to 2024, federal crash data recorded 13 fatal motor-vehicle crashes in the city, killing 13 people — 15.0 traffic deaths per 100,000 residents per year, above the national average of 12.3.
Loganville ranks #41 out of 70 ranked cities in Georgia and #317 out of 2,153 nationally for road danger (most dangerous first). The score is a percentile: a higher traffic-fatality rate than about 85% of ranked US cities.
The most distinctive factor in Loganville's fatal crashes: dark / nighttime conditions — 69% of fatal crashes, versus 50% nationally.
What’s Behind Loganville’s Fatal Crashes (2020–2024)
Share of the city’s 13 fatal crashes where each factor was recorded. Factors overlap, so shares don’t sum to 100%.
| Crash Factor | Fatal Crashes | Loganville | National Avg |
|---|---|---|---|
| Drinking driver involved | 5 | 38.5% | 25.9% |
| Speeding involved | 6 | 46.2% | 28.2% |
| Pedestrian or cyclist involved | 2 | 15.4% | 22.5% |
| Dark / nighttime conditions | 9 | 69.2% | 49.8% |
Loganville Traffic Deaths by Year
Annual traffic fatalities in Loganville, Georgia from NHTSA FARS. Single-year swings are normal in smaller cities; the Road Danger Score uses the full 5-year window.
| Year | Traffic Deaths |
|---|---|
| 2024 | 4 |
| 2023 | 1 |
| 2022 | 4 |
| 2021 | 2 |
| 2020 | 2 |
